vba 相关问题

Visual Basic for Applications(VBA)是一种用于编写宏的事件驱动的面向对象编程语言,用于整个Office套件以及其他应用程序。 VBA不等同于VB.NET或VBS;如果您在Visual Studio中工作,请使用[vb.net]。如果您的问题专门针对编程任何MS Office应用程序,请使用相应的标记:[excel],[ms-access],[ms-word],[outlook]或[microsoft-project]。

如何通过引用其id来获取元素的innerText?

代码大师!新手在这里!我试图创建一个工具,使用.innerText方法从网站上抓取文本,通过id引用元素,但是有些id只能得到空格和/或中断....

回答 1 投票 0

保持VBA中的变量值

出于某种原因,当在VBA中使用Select Case语句时,我似乎在语句完成后丢失了我的变量值。对于上下文,我试图捕获两个双击动作...

回答 3 投票 -1

将不同的工作簿合并为一个

我有97本不同的工作簿。我想将它们合并为一个工作簿。经过一番搜索后,我发现了这段代码并进行了一些修改当我按F5时,没有错误发生。但我没有看到任何结果......

回答 2 投票 0

用户取消对话框时,选择要在没有宏的情况下保存的文件夹

我的代码提示用户将当前文件保存为宏免费文件,问题是如果用户点击取消,那我就会收到错误。我需要我的代码在用户点击取消时重新开始。所以它会......

回答 2 投票 -1

VBA无法转置数据(从一个工作簿复制到已关闭的书)

我正在尝试编写一个代码,该代码将从一个工作簿中复制数据并将其保存到已关闭的书中。问题是我需要从列到行转换的数据。我试过粘贴特价但是......

回答 1 投票 1

Excel宏中的Visual Basics 400错误

单击我的宏时出现400错误,当我在Visual Basic中并使用F8步进时它工作正常但是当我点击Calculate Stats宏时它会给出400错误并且......

回答 2 投票 0

VBA运行shell命令但要从不同的目录运行

我的代码如下:ChDir(ActiveWorkbook.Path)ShellString =“cmd.exe / k cpdf -split”+ Chr(34)+“。\”+ Replace(File,“。csv”,“。pdf”)+ Chr(34)+“ - o temp / x _ %%%。pdf”Shell ShellString,...

回答 1 投票 0

我需要列“F”中的单元格来清除何时在“J”列的同一行中更新了训练日期

我需要列“F”中的单元格,以便在“J”列的同一行中更新培训日期时清除内容。

回答 1 投票 -3

如何将PowerPoint VBA脚本应用于选择的形状?

我想在幻灯片上选择多个形状,然后在所有选定的形状上运行一个宏。例如:我想用给定的值增加形状的动画延迟时间。注意:有些形状可能......

回答 1 投票 0

VBA代码,用于查找和选择包含特定字符串的范围内的多个单元格

我想在范围“B17:B29”中查找字符串“GAS CYLINDERS”,如果单元格包含给定的字符串,请转到包含字符串的单元格的同一行的“H”列(来自“B”)然后,选择......

回答 2 投票 -3

使用VBA Excel中的If语句创建摘要表

我有一个包含以下一系列列的工作表:我需要创建一个摘要表,我可以通过ID将所有“Y”条目相加,这样摘要表将显示每列Y的计数,因此......

回答 1 投票 -5

在VBA编辑器中找不到应用断点的灰色边距

我以某种方式挤压了在VBA编辑器中应用断点的边距。我仍然可以使用快捷键应用断点,但我不能将控件滚动到上一行而不拖动它...

回答 1 投票 2

如何自动隐藏excel中的行

我有一个出勤跟踪器,用于发送班次结束报告。目前,我全班的出席节目。我想创建一个隐藏0次错过行的宏。空白追踪器2 ....

回答 3 投票 -1

基于用户输入的动态隐藏列

我有一个工作表,列出了第14行的年份,其中各种值都低于这些年份。我想要一个用户输入单元格,他们可以输入他们想要看到的年数,而...

回答 1 投票 0

VBA - 过度使用IF语句

请记住,我是VBA的首发开发人员。我有一大堆IF语句,我100%确定这可以而且必须更短,但我不知道如何这样做。如果...

回答 7 投票 0

具有excel IF,索引,匹配功能的复杂VBA功能

请帮我创建具有excel IF,索引,匹配功能的VBA功能。这是我的excel功能:= IF(INDEX(网格!$ B $ 3:$ G $ 6,MATCH('Sal-Data'!$ A2,网格!$ A $ 3:$ A $ 6,0),MATCH('Sal-数据'!$ B2 + 1,电网!$ B $ ...

回答 2 投票 0

如何在数组中插入数据(在循环内)?

我有一个插入数据到数组的问题。在程序中,我使用“Data:”值搜索所有单元格。如果出现此值,我跳转到右边的单元格并标记它。我想收集所有标记的......

回答 2 投票 0

将实现ATL接口的VBA类传递给ATL方法

编辑:我有一个ATL简单对象MyATLObject,只有一个方法:STDMETHODIMP CMyATLObject :: EVAL(DOUBLE * x,long AddressOfFunc){* x = toto (*((FCTPTR)AddressOfFunc)); ...

回答 1 投票 1

直接运行.exe并通过Shell VBA返回不同的结果

当我直接单击.exe文件“PrintUsers.exe”时,输出是正确的。但是当我使用Shell通过VBA执行此操作时,结果会有所不同。它试图在另一个目录中找到该文本文件。 ...

回答 2 投票 -1

Excel宏用于复制多个xml文件的内容并粘贴到excel行中

我在一个文件夹中有多个xml文件(例如100个xml文件),我的要求是创建一个宏来复制xml文件的内容并将其粘贴到excel表中。例如:第一个xml文件内容 - > ...

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.